Kinematic Redundancy in Robot Design: Benefits and Challenges in Real-world Applications

Kinematic redundancy in robot design refers to the inclusion of extra degrees of freedom beyond what is necessary for a specific task. This design approach can enhance a robot’s flexibility and ability to adapt to complex environments. However, it also introduces certain challenges that must be addressed during development and operation.

Benefits of Kinematic Redundancy

One primary advantage is improved obstacle avoidance. Redundant joints allow robots to navigate around obstacles more effectively without compromising the task. Additionally, redundancy can increase the robot’s dexterity, enabling more precise movements and complex manipulations. It also provides fault tolerance; if one joint fails, others can compensate, maintaining functionality.

Challenges in Implementation

Implementing kinematic redundancy requires sophisticated control algorithms to coordinate multiple joints. This complexity can lead to increased computational demands and potential instability. Moreover, designing redundant systems involves higher costs and more intricate maintenance procedures. Ensuring smooth and coordinated movement across all degrees of freedom is also a significant challenge.

Real-World Applications

Redundant robots are used in manufacturing, where they perform complex assembly tasks. They are also employed in medical robotics for minimally invasive surgeries, offering enhanced precision and flexibility. In space exploration, redundancy allows robots to adapt to unpredictable environments and continue functioning despite component failures.

  • Manufacturing automation
  • Medical surgery robots
  • Space exploration robots
  • Search and rescue operations